Brent Oil retreats from $109.68 peak as WTI fades from $104.44

Brent Oil and Crude Oil WTI have both pulled back sharply after parabolic rallies stalled against heavy selling. Brent trades at $105.13, down from a $109.68 peak, while WTI sits at $100.45 after a rejection at $104.44, and traders now watch key support levels to gauge whether the pullback deepens.

Brent's rally hits a wall

Brent Oil surged to $109.68 before a high-volume rejection reversed the move, and the price now sits at $105.13, more than 4% below that high. The five-hour RSI has cooled to 67.8, still in overbought territory, while the ADX reads 43.1, showing the broader uptrend remains strong even as momentum fades. The SuperTrend indicator marks support at $102.70, a level that stays bullish unless broken.

WTI fades from its own peak

Crude Oil WTI surged to $104.44 before heavy selling pushed it back down, and bulls now defend the $97.54 SuperTrend line. The five-hour ADX has climbed to 44.64 even as RSI cooled from an overbought 68.1, and a confirmed bearish engulfing pattern points to buyer exhaustion. WTI still holds above the Ichimoku Cloud between $93.34 and $98.24 and above its 20-period SMA at $96.41, keeping the broader bullish structure intact.

Where the next move gets decided

Brent's $102.70–$106.50 range counts as a chop zone, where momentum offers no clear direction. WTI's $97.50–$101.50 band forms a similar no-trade zone, and a five-hour close below $97.54 likely flips WTI's structure to bear-controlled. A break of Brent's $102.70 support level opens the case for a deeper slide toward the $96.45 SMA 50 target. On the Brent chart, the $100.35 Fibonacci retracement 23.6% level marks the first pullback magnet after a parabolic run of this kind, via the Fibonacci retracement tool.
